FILE- PHOTO New York: US journalist, author and columnist Jean Carroll, during a court hearing against Donald Trump, alleged that the country’s former president had sex in a luxury department store Had raped her. “I’m here because Donald Trump raped me and when I wrote about it, he denied doing it,” Carroll told the judges. They lied and ruined my reputation. I have come here to fight the case and get back my reputation and life.” When Carroll was testifying in court about the alleged rape of her in 1996, Trump called the matter a “fake and false story” on his social media platform ‘Truth Social’. In view of these comments of Trump, the judge warned his lawyer that doing so could increase the former President’s legal troubles. Carroll told the court she met Trump at Bergdorf Goodman on a Thursday evening in 1996, where Trump asked her for help buying women’s lingerie and raped her in the changing room. Carroll said she was also afraid that people would blame her for what happened to her. He said that he decided to tell people about his ordeal after the “Me Too” campaign. Trump has vehemently denied these allegations. (agency)
